Colli Reaches 2024 St. Galler Elite Challenge Quarters

Jan 18 - 21, 2024

Cortina d’Ampezzo, Italy

Giacomo Colli (Cortina d’Ampezzo, ITA) qualified for the 2024 St. Galler Elite Challenge playoffs, dropping their quarterfinals match 7-3 against Kyle Waddell (Hamilton, SCO).
 
Colli finished 2-2 in the 15-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Colli lost 6-3 to Waddell, then responded with a 7-4 win over Jan Iseli (Solothun, SUI). Colli won 9-5 against Konrad Stych (Warsaw, POL). Colli went on to lose 6-4 against Yves Stocker (Zug, SUI) in their final qualifying round match.
 
Colli earned 9.000 world rankings points for their Top 5 finish in the St. Galler Elite Challenge, moving up 22 spots the World Ranking Standings into 96th place overall with 30.375 total points. Colli ranks 95th overall on the Year-to-Date rankings with 23.625 points earned so far this season.
